Our soap bars are also not a detergent. Many commercial bars
are actually a detergent bar. The distinction may not seem to
be important until you realize that detergents are a petroleum
derivative. Detergents came into widespread use during World
War II as the answer to vegetable oil and animal fat shortages
and their use has continued because for removing dirt and oils,
they were sometimes as good or better than soap - and much cheaper
to produce. However, the same properties that make detergents
good cleaning agents, also make them harsh and drying to your
skin.
